ALEXANDRA -– Shoppers find a toddler in a taxi rank toilet and hand him over to Alex police.

A toddler was found in the public toilets of a taxi rank at Alex Mall in Alexandra on 3 March at about 6pm.

This was after members of the public spotted the little boy who seemed to have been abandoned. The child was then taken to Alexandra Police Station.

Alex police spokesperson Sergeant Simphiwe Mbatha confirmed that the parents came to the station a few hours later and took him home.

The South African Police Service offered the following tips when parents are in public spaces with their children:

Make an outing to a mall or park an educational experience in which your children practise checking with you, going to the bathroom with a friend and finding adults who may be able to help if they need assistance.

Do not let your children wear clothing or carry items that bear their names in public. It makes it too easy for a stranger to approach them.
